I am a prime number. I am greater than 50, but less than 80. When you add my digits together you get 16. What number am I?

Answer:

79

Step-by-step explanation:

7 + 9 = 16

the number 79 is divisible only by 1 and the number itself. since 79 has exactly two factors, i.e. 1 and 79, it is a prime number.
